Nature of stimulus received and transmitted by neurons
Describe the nature of stimulus received and transmitted by neurons?
Expert
Neurons receive and transmit chemical stimuli via neurotransmitters discharged in the synapses. All along the neuron body though the impulse transmission is electrical. Therefore neurons conduct chemical and electric stimuli.
